Leigh Academy Cherry Orchard has a fantastic opportunity to appoint a Teaching Assistant (Apprentice) to join and support our classes in our highly successful academy that opened in 2017. This role is ideal for those who genuinely have a passion for helping children within a primary setting.What does the role involve? The main aim of this role is to support our teachers to deliver academic excellence, day in, day out, with professionalism and enthusiasm. This will involve providing a comprehensive support service to the Academy including:

  • Assisting students with their educational and social development, on an individual and group basis
  • Providing support for individual students inside and outside the classroom to enable them to fully participate in activities
  • Assisting teachers with the maintenance of student records
  • Building and maintaining successful relationships with students, whilst treating them with respect and consideration
  • Provide expertise to deliver a personalised curriculum for each pupil's learning
  • Work together with families and other agencies to ensure every pupil is valued, challenged and supported
  • Have the highest expectation that every pupil will make sustained academic and personal progress, Each and every member of staff, regardless of their position or seniority, is expected to participate in the overall running of the school and to act as a positive role model for our students. We offer in-house Continuing Professional Development and you'll be part of a highly experienced and efficient team - you'll be learning from the very best!This is a fixed-term position, working 37.5 hours per week, term time + 1 week of inset and offers an actual salary of £14,122 per annum (£16,200 full-time equivalent).Working for the academyLeigh Academy Cherry Orchard is a new two-form entry primary academy for students between the ages of 3 to 11 that opened in September 2017. The academy admits a maximum of 60 children into each year between Reception and Year 6 having initially opened with places available in Reception, Year 1 and Year 2. We have continued to expand and from September 2021 we have children up to year 6 and with every year group at full capacity.The academy enjoys brand new facilities, a nursery for pre-school age children, and a small centre for children with speech, communication and language needs. At the heart of Ebbsfleet Garden City, Leigh Academy Cherry Orchard is the focal point of this brand new community, providing local families with an outstanding educational facility.At Cherry Orchard Primary Academy we will:
